"The Last Week"
Have you ever wondered what the final week of Jesus
on earth was like? Come and listen to two renowned
biblical scholars tell and explain the last week of
Jesus' life on earth as given in the Gospel According
to Mark. Come take a journey to Jerusalem. Follow
the footsteps of Jesus as he made his way to Calvary.
For five Thursday evenings, we will engage in discussions
prompted by the writings of Marcus Borg and John Dominic
Crossan . We will use their book: "The Last Week",
and supplement the discussions with a slide show of
the Via Dolorosa [The way of the Cross], taken from
our Rector's sabbatical trip to the Holy Land. Come
for a time of prayer, reflection and education on
the most significant week in Christian history.
If you wish to acquire the book and read ahead of
time, you can find a paper back version at amazon.com
or barnesandnoble.com for $10.98. We will begin with
soup and bread at 5:30PM, and start the discussion
at 6PM, ending at 7PM. The dates for this Lenten program
are: March 1st, 8th, 15th, 22nd, and 29th.

MAKE A DIFFERENCE –
BE A FAMILY MENTOR Your encouragement and
support can make a real difference in the life of
a low-income, formerly homeless family that is struggling
to become more self-reliant. The IHN PLUS Mentoring
Program was developed to extend the services of The
Interfaith Hospitality Network. It connects volunteer
mentors with families who are trying to create more
positive futures. The mentor builds a committed, trusting
relationship with a couple or individual. The focus
of the relationship is on helping families develop
a clear picture of what they want and planning the
steps they can take to bring their dreams into reality.
No special skills are required – just a willingness
to draw on your own life experience, to listen and
to help others. 1-2 hours per week for one year plus
initial training class is required. Classes starting
